Interim Manager, Development Events and Operations
The Trustees of Reservations is Massachusetts' premier conservation and preservation organization, and they are seeking an Interim Manager of Development Events and Operations. This role involves driving fundraising success through the strategic execution of over 40 annual events and fostering strong donor relationships.

Responsibilities
Facilitate event vendor research and coordination
Build donor prospect lists based on past interest / participation
Draft donor and committee update emails and agendas for meetings
Maintain accurate budget documents for events
Assist with event lead up preparations for registration needs and run of show documents
Maintain positive donor relations and manage the events@thetrustees.org email inbox
Maintain accurate ticket sales, registrations, and event reporting
Effectively utilize and update Salesforce and other systems to ensure accurate and complete event data
Build invitation criteria and event invitation lists and collaborate with marketing teams to create invitations, website content, message points, and collateral for all events
Maintain and track event ticket sales via Classy/GoFundMe, ACME, or another ticketing system
Act as the primary lead on Fundraising Event Auctions
Support and actively participate in the planning and implementation of all Development and Governance Events

The Trustees of Reservations
Founded by landscape architect Charles Eliot in 1891, The Trustees has, for more than 125 years, been a catalyst for important ideas, endeavors, and progress in Massachusetts.
